Output 34fbbe84f97303ac7844395a991f7a59f38f3ea64f225b150171e4be59d46a07:1

value
20994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e749b23c3b2868da664dfe524514e6d844596ce OP_EQUAL
address
3QtTFCMd7jDHqf3uUHos2dfct6Zc3UEFFr
transaction
34fbbe84f97303ac7844395a991f7a59f38f3ea64f225b150171e4be59d46a07